Located in Frederick, MD, Smith Berch Inc provides outpatient detoxification services, substance use treatment, and options for methadone, buprenorphine, or naltrexone therapies. This center has a strong emphasis on techniques such as 12-step facilitation, brief intervention, and cognitive behavioral therapy. By focusing on personalized care, the facility serves adults and young adults of all genders.
